ISO 230 is titled:
"Test code for machine tools"
This standard series provides methods and criteria for testing the accuracy, repeatability, and behavior of machine tools. It consists of multiple parts, each focused on a specific aspect of machine performance. Some key parts include:
This standard is essential for machine tool manufacturers, CNC operators, maintenance engineers, and industrial quality inspectors to evaluate how accurately and consistently machines perform under specified conditions.
